Adventure in Dubai: A 5-Day Itinerary

Embark on an exciting adventure in Dubai with this 5-day itinerary that combines thrilling activities, breathtaking sights, and hidden gems. From soaring through the desert dunes to exploring modern architectural marvels, experience the best of Dubai while maintaining a medium budget. Day 1: Desert Safari and Camel Riding

Start your adventure with an exhilarating Desert Safari experience. In the morning, embark on a dune bashing adventure in a 4x4 vehicle, zooming through the golden sands of the Arabian Desert. Afterward, enjoy camel riding, sandboarding, and quad biking. As the evening approaches, indulge in a traditional Arabian dinner and watch mesmerizing belly dance performances under the starlit sky.

  • Desert Safari: Estimated cost: AED 250 ($68) per person, Time: Half-day
Restaurants
  • For breakfast, head to The Arabian Tea House, a charming café offering a variety of traditional Arabian breakfast dishes such as falafel, hummus, and shakshuka. The average cost for a meal is about 50 AED per person.
  • For lunch, try Al Fanar Restaurant & Café, which specializes in Emirati cuisine. Enjoy dishes like machbous, harees, and luqaimat in a cozy and nostalgic setting. The average cost for a meal is about 80 AED per person.
  • For dinner, experience the vibrant flavors of Middle Eastern cuisine at Amaseena in The Ritz-Carlton. Indulge in delicious mezze, grilled meats, and traditional Arabian desserts amidst stunning views. The average cost for a meal is about 250 AED per person.
Day 2: Skydiving and Burj Khalifa

Get your adrenaline pumping with a skydiving experience above the stunning Palm Jumeirah Island. Soar through the sky and enjoy breathtaking views of Dubai's skyline and coastline.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world. Take an elevator ride to the observation deck on the 148th floor for panoramic views of the city. Wrap up the day by exploring the Dubai Mall, located at the foot of Burj Khalifa.

  • Skydiving: Estimated cost: AED 1,700 ($463) per person, Time: 2-3 hours
  • Burj Khalifa & Dubai Mall: Estimated cost: AED 200 ($54) per person, Time: Half-day
Restaurants
  • Start your day with a delicious breakfast at Jones the Grocer, where you can enjoy a variety of international dishes made with fresh ingredients. Average cost for a meal is about 60 AED per person.
  • For lunch, head over to the Dubai Marina and indulge in some seafood delights at Pierchic. Enjoy the stunning views of the Arabian Gulf while savoring their delectable seafood dishes. Average cost for a meal is about 300 AED per person.
  • For dinner, treat yourself to a memorable dining experience at At.mosphere, located on the 122nd floor of the Burj Khalifa. Delight in their gourmet European cuisine and panoramic views of the city. Average cost for a meal is about 800 AED per person.
Day 3: Hatta Hiking and Kayaking

Escape the bustling city and head to Hatta, a picturesque mountain town located on the outskirts of Dubai. Spend the morning hiking through the Hatta Mountain Conservation Area, admiring the rugged landscapes, rocky hills, and natural pools. Afterward, satisfy your adventurous side by kayaking in the serene Hatta Dam. Enjoy the tranquility of nature before returning to Dubai in the evening.

  • Hatta Mountain Hiking: Estimated cost: AED 30 ($8) per person, Time: Half-day
  • Hatta Dam Kayaking: Estimated cost: AED 60 ($16) per person, Time: 2-3 hours
Day 4: Aquaventure Waterpark and Dubai Marina

Cool off and have a blast at the Aquaventure Waterpark located within Atlantis, The Palm. Spend the morning enjoying thrilling water slides, lazy river rides, and a visit to the famous Leap of Faith. In the afternoon, head to Dubai Marina, a vibrant waterfront district. Take a relaxing boat ride along the marina, explore the luxurious yachts, and indulge in delicious cuisine at one of the many waterfront restaurants.

  • Aquaventure Waterpark: Estimated cost: AED 320 ($87) per person, Time: Half-day
  • Dubai Marina: Estimated cost: Free, Time: Half-day
Day 5: Dubai Miracle Garden and Wild Wadi Waterpark

End your adventure with a visit to Dubai Miracle Garden, a stunning floral oasis showcasing intricate designs made entirely of flowers. Explore the vibrant displays and capture incredible photos. In the afternoon, head to Wild Wadi Waterpark for some adrenaline-pumping water rides and attractions. Enjoy the thrilling water slides and wave pools before bidding farewell to Dubai.

  • Dubai Miracle Garden: Estimated cost: AED 55 ($15) per person, Time: Half-day
  • Wild Wadi Waterpark: Estimated cost: AED 336 ($92) per person, Time: Half-day

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For off the beaten path adventures, consider visiting the Al Qudra Lakes located in the Dubai Desert Conservation Reserve. This scenic spot offers stunning views of the desert, serene lakes, and the opportunity to spot local wildlife. Another hidden gem is the Ras Al Khor Wildlife Sanctuary, a wetland reserve home to migratory birds. Explore the mangroves and observe flamingos in their natural habitat.
